Ref apologises to Carnegie

Leeds Carnegie have received an apology from referee David Rose for disallowing them a try just before half-time last Sunday at Guinness Premiership leaders London Wasps in a game Leeds only lost 21-15.

Leeds, who had to settle for a losing bonus point from their best performance of the season to date, appeared to take a crucial 11-6 lead with the conversion to come.

But Saracens scored with the last play of the half to give themselves the advantage.

Leeds’ director of rugby Andy Key said: “Credit to David Rose.

"He has phoned us this week having seen the game on video and admitted that the try should have been given.

"If we score then the game has a completely different complexion.”
